Abstract
The capacity of GSM mobile radio networks using various smart antenna concepts is investigated by means of computer simulations. The values derived are compared with those of a GSM network with currently available features such as frequency hopping (FH), power control (PC) and discontinuous transmission (DTX) to estimate the additional benefit from smart antennas
